Turkish Language - A Deep Look
The Turkish language, which people often call Türkçe, really stands out as the most widely spoken of the Turkic languages. It's a member of the Oghuz branch, and there are, you know, around 90 million people who speak it. This language, also known as Türkiye Türkçesi, which just means 'Turkish of Turkey', has a really interesting sound to it. It has a rhythm that, in a way, feels very unique, and its structure is quite different from many European languages, for example. People who hear it for the first time often notice its distinct flow and pronunciation, which is pretty cool.
When you think about the history of languages, Turkish has a long and rather rich story. It's the direct descendant of Ottoman Turkish, a language that was spoken in the vast Ottoman Empire for centuries. This means it carries a lot of history within its words and grammar. Over time, it has changed and adapted, but its core identity remains. It's a language that has seen empires rise and fall, and it has been the voice of poets, scholars, and everyday people for a very, very long time.

The Turkish Language Family and Its Connections
Turkish, as we've talked about, is a member of the Oghuz branch of the Turkic language family. This means it has a lot of relatives, you know, languages that share a common ancestor and therefore have similar structures and words. It is quite closely related to Azerbaijani, Turkmen, Qashqai, Gagauz, and Balkan Gagauz Turkish. There is, in fact, considerable overlap and shared features among these languages.
The Turkish language, being the major member of the Turkic language family, is spoken not just in Turkey but also in Cyprus and other places in Europe and the Middle East. It’s interesting to see how a language can spread and take root in various regions, carrying its heritage with it. This wide distribution shows its historical significance and its enduring presence.
One of the really neat things about Turkish is that it is mutually intelligible with Azerbaijani. This means that speakers of Turkish and Azerbaijani can generally understand each other, even though they are distinct languages. It's like, they are close enough that communication is often possible without a translator, which is a pretty cool example of linguistic kinship.
This connection highlights the deep historical and cultural ties between the people who speak these languages. They share a common linguistic heritage that goes back centuries, and this shared background is reflected in the words they use and the way they put sentences together. It’s a testament to how languages evolve and branch out while still maintaining a core identity.
